Florian Eyben is a scholar working on Signal Processing, Artificial Intelligence and Experimental and Cognitive Psychology. According to data from OpenAlex, Florian Eyben has authored 107 papers receiving a total of 7.7k indexed citations (citations by other indexed papers that have themselves been cited), including 75 papers in Signal Processing, 61 papers in Artificial Intelligence and 49 papers in Experimental and Cognitive Psychology. Recurrent topics in Florian Eyben’s work include Music and Audio Processing (58 papers), Speech and Audio Processing (52 papers) and Speech Recognition and Synthesis (46 papers). Florian Eyben is often cited by papers focused on Music and Audio Processing (58 papers), Speech and Audio Processing (52 papers) and Speech Recognition and Synthesis (46 papers). Florian Eyben collaborates with scholars based in Germany, United Kingdom and Switzerland. Florian Eyben's co-authors include Björn W. Schuller, Martin Wöllmer, Felix Weninger, Gerhard Rigoll, Florian Groß, Klaus R. Scherer, Roddy Cowie, Shrikanth Narayanan, Maja Pantić and Johan Sundberg and has published in prestigious journals such as PLoS ONE, IEEE Transactions on Pattern Analysis and Machine Intelligence and The Journal of the Acoustical Society of America.
